About This Opportunity
We are representing a confidential aerospace organization based in Munich, Germany, seeking an experienced EMC/EMI Engineer. Our client is advancing innovative technologies in the space sector, and this role will be critical to ensuring electromagnetic compatibility across complex spacecraft systems. As the recruiting partner, Get A Job.ai will guide you through the entire application and interview process.
Responsibilities
- Provide expert guidance on EMC/EMI design practices to ensure spacecraft systems meet all relevant standards and requirements
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to integrate EMC/EMI considerations into the design phase of spacecraft systems and subsystems
- Review and analyze design documents, schematics, and layout plans to identify potential EMC/EMI issues
- Develop and implement comprehensive EMC/EMI test plans and procedures for spacecraft systems
- Conduct EMC/EMI testing, including pre-compliance and compliance testing using spectrum analyzers, network analyzers, and EMI receivers
- Analyze test data, identify non-conformities, and recommend corrective actions to resolve EMC/EMI issues
- Ensure all designs and test procedures comply with relevant EMC/EMI standards including MIL-STD-461, CISPR, and DO-160
- Stay updated with the latest developments in EMC/EMI standards and incorporate them into design and testing processes
- Prepare detailed technical reports, test summaries, and design documentation related to EMC/EMI activities
- Provide technical support and training to engineering teams on EMC/EMI best practices and mitigation techniques
What We're Looking For
Required Qualifications:
- Bachelor's or Master's degree in Electrical Engineering, Electronics Engineering, or a related field
- Minimum of 5 years of experience in EMC/EMI engineering, preferably in the aerospace or defense industry
- Strong knowledge of EMC/EMI principles, test methods, and mitigation techniques
- Experience with EMC/EMI standards such as MIL-STD-461, CISPR, and DO-160
- Proficiency in using EMC/EMI testing equipment, including spectrum analyzers, network analyzers, and EMI receivers
- Exc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work effectively in a team environment
- Ability to manage multiple projects and priorities in a fast-paced environment
Preferred Qualifications:
- Experience with spacecraft systems and subsystems
- Knowledge of signal integrity and power integrity as they relate to EMC/EMI
- Experience with simulation tools for EMC/EMI analysis
